JAMB - Chemistry (1978 - No. 8)
The oxidation state of chlorine in potassium chlorate is?
+1
+2
+3
+5
+7
Explanation
- potassium chlorate --> KClO\(_3\)
valencies of K = +1, O = -2.
: (+1) + Cl + ( -2 X 3 atoms ) = 0
Cl + 1 - 6 = 0
Cl = 5
∴ The oxidation state of chlorine in potassium chlorate is +5
